Planting Calendar for Caladium

Frost tolerance for caladium: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ost.

Caladium require warm weather which means that it is necessary to wait until it warms up after all chance of frost has passed before you can plant them.

The earliest that you can plant caladium in Yelm is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ant caladium and expect a good harvest is probably August. Any later than that and your caladium may not have a chance to really do well. You can get started a little bit earlier by starting your caladium indoors.

Last Frost Date

The average date of last frost is March 15 in Yelm. You should expect an average low temperature of 10°F in the coldest months of winter.

Since the USDA zone info for Yelm is an average the actual date of last frost can change quite a bit from year to year. Half of the time in Yelm last frost occurs after March 15 so make sure that you are prepared to protect your caladium in the event of a surprise late frost.
